On Sunday, September 13, 2026, H.E. Archbishop Kegham Khacherian, Prelate of the Western Prelacy of the United States, celebrated Divine Liturgy and delivered the sermon at Holy Cross Armenian Apostolic Cathedral in Montebello on the occasion of the Feast of the Exaltation of the Holy Cross.

Serving at the Holy Altar was Rev. Fr. Haroutyoun Karapetyan, Pastor of Holy Cross Armenian Apostolic Cathedral, assisted by deacons and scribes, with the participation of the church choir. The Cathedral was filled with faithful parishioners and members of the extended church family. Also in attendance was National Delegate Mr. Joe Samuelian.

In his sermon, Archbishop Khacherian reflected on the hymn composed for the feast and spoke about the profound spiritual meaning of the Holy Cross. He explained that, beyond the historical account of the discovery of the True Cross and its renewed significance throughout the Christian world, the Feast of the Exaltation of the Holy Cross holds a special place as one of the five major feasts of the Armenian Apostolic Church.

“The Cross is the symbol of Christianity. It is the refuge and strength of Christians throughout the world. Beyond the material value of the wood of the Cross, it symbolizes the crucified Christ, who came into the world, was crucified, and rose from the dead. By conquering death, Jesus Christ delivered us from our sins and reconciled us with God the Father, opening before us the path to eternal life,” the Prelate stated.

At the conclusion of the Divine Liturgy, Archbishop Khacherian also reflected with faith and fatherly affection on the opening of the 2026–2027 academic year of the Sunday Schools operating under the auspices of the churches of the Western Prelacy. On this occasion, he commended the organizing bodies, volunteer educators, students receiving Armenian Christian education, and their parents for their commitment to nurturing the faith and Armenian identity of the younger generation.

Following the service, the Prelate proceeded to Bagramian Hall, where he conducted the traditional blessing of basil and madagh.

In honor of Archbishop Khacherian and on the occasion of the Cathedral’s name day, the Board of Trustees had organized a fellowship luncheon. The Prelate presided over the luncheon and broke bread with members of the extended church family in an atmosphere filled with fraternal love and divine blessings.

Archbishop Khacherian expressed his appreciation to all those present and to the church’s dedicated volunteers for their active participation in community life and their contributions to the success of the Cathedral’s programs and initiatives. He concluded by extending his fatherly blessings and well wishes to the entire community.
